Direct access: 貧乏 , 部員 , 部下 , 部会 , 武器 , 奉行 , 武士 , 不躾 , 部首 , 部署 貧乏pronunciation: binbou kanji characters: 貧 , 乏translation: poverty 貧乏な: binbouna: poor, needy 貧乏する: binbousuru: become poor, be in poverty 貧乏に成る: binbouninaru <<< 成 貧乏揺り: binbouyusuri: shaking oneself <<< 揺 貧乏人: binbounin: poor person <<< 人 貧乏所帯: binboushotai: needy family <<< 所帯 器用貧乏: kiyoubinbou: a Jack of all trades and a master of none <<< 器用 synonyms: 貧困 antonyms: 金持 部員pronunciation: buin kanji characters: 部 , 員 keyword: sport , jobtranslation: member (of a club), staff check also: 会員 部下pronunciation: buka kanji characters: 部 , 下 keyword: jobtranslation: subordinate, junior partner check also: 手下 部会pronunciation: bukai kanji characters: 部 , 会 keyword: jobtranslation: sectional meeting
武器pronunciation: buki kanji characters: 武 , 器 keyword: weapontranslation: arms, weapon, weaponry 武器を取る: bukiotoru: take up arms, rise in arms against <<< 取 武器を捨てる: bukiosuteru: lay down one's arms <<< 捨 武器商: bukishou: gunsmith, armourer <<< 商 武器庫: bukiko: arsenal, armory, armoury <<< 庫 武器工場: bukikoujou <<< 工場 武器援助: bukienjo: arms aid <<< 援助 武器弾薬: bukidannyaku: munitions <<< 弾薬 武器密輸: bukimitsuyu: arms smuggling, weapons smuggling <<< 密輸 武器よ去らば: bukiyosaraba: A Farewell to Arms (Ernest Hemingway's novel, 1929) <<< 去 強力な武器: kyouryokunabuki: destructive weapon <<< 強力 synonyms: 兵器 奉行pronunciation: bugyou kanji characters: 奉 , 行 keyword: japanese historytranslation: magistrate [administrator,minister] in medieval Japan 町奉行: machibugyou: magistrate of police and justice system in a feudal Japanese city <<< 町 長崎奉行: nagasakibugyou: Governor of Nagasaki (during Edo period) <<< 長崎 武士pronunciation: bushi, mononohu kanji characters: 武 , 士 keyword: japanese historytranslation: samurai, warrior, knight 武士道: bushidou: bushido, chivalry, chivalrousness <<< 道 , 武道 武士気質: bushikatagi <<< 気質 武士気質の: bushikatagino: samurai spirited, knightly 武士階級: bushikaikyuu: samurai classes <<< 階級 check also: 騎士 , Samurai 不躾pronunciation: bushitsuke kanji characters: 不 , 躾translation: bad manner, rudeness 不躾な: bushitsukena: ill-mannered, rude, impolite 不躾ですが: bushitsukedesuga: 'Excuse me, but' 部首pronunciation: bushu kanji characters: 部 , 首 keyword: grammartranslation: radical [component] of a kanji [Chinese] character 部署pronunciation: busho kanji characters: 部 , 署 keyword: jobtranslation: one's post, one's place of duty 部署に就く: bushonitsuku: take one's post, take up one's station, go to quarters <<< 就 部署を守る: bushoomamoru: keep one's post <<< 守 部署に留まる: bushonitodomaru <<< 留
